“Rough & Tough & Dangerous - The Singles 94/98” ( Russian “Rough and Tough and Dangerous - Singles 94/98” ) is the first Scooter album released on January 19, 1998 . For the album, the group released a new single, “No Fate”. In addition, the second CD, for the first time, released “Valleé de Larmes”, which was not included in previous albums.

About the album
The 1st CD “Rough & Tough & Dangerous - The Singles 94/98” includes: 11 tracks (most of the title ones) from all the band’s singles from 1994 to 1997 and the new single “No Fate”. It also included 4 live versions of some songs from concerts.
On CD 2, 7 remixes and 6 b-sides were presented (excluding: “The Silence of T. 1210 MK II”, “Wednesday” and “Choir Dance”) from the released singles.
“Valleé de Larmes” was featured in a crafted version of “The Loop!”
The album was released at the very end of 1997 , so the bulk of sales came in 1998 .
A 12-clip video cassette, Rough & Tough & Dangerous, was also released.

Rewards and Chart
“Rough & Tough & Dangerous - The Singles 94/98” received 1 gold record. Below are the awards and achievements of the compilation album on the charts. [2]
- Sweden - Gold, 18
- Finland - 2
- Germany - 8
- Norway - 12
- Austria - 47
